Heads up: Quillbase (the vendor behind our SQL linter, Sievecheck) pushed new default rules that flag uppercase keywords and missing semicolons. Our repos will get noisy until we pin the ruleset, which Priya is handling Monday. If the lint gate blocks a hotfix before then, you can override with the standard waiver. Vendor questions go to the address below.

escalation mailbox, bafog-fafog: ulador@paliqlabs.internal

Q: How do I register a third-party validator in the Sievewright plugin system?

A: Implement the `Validator` interface from the Sievewright SDK, declare schema compatibility in the manifest, and ensure your checks are side-effect free — reviewers should reject any plugin that mutates input records. Signed manifests are verified at load time against the Ashfell trust store. To re-sign the trust store after adding a plugin, you must supply the recovery passphrase, which is:

vault phrase of bagaf-kajeg = jorath-feniel-briir-siliel-ralix

**Alert: tailfox CLI — tail session failures**

The tailfox CLI is failing to open tail sessions against the Greymarsh log brokers. Error rate above 30% for 15 minutes. Release impact: deploy verification relies on live tails, so holds may be needed. Workaround: use the batch-pull mode until sessions recover. Triage steps and current broker status are tracked on the page below.

dashboard of bajef-bageg = https://confluence.lumiclabs.internal/browse/browse/pages/display/93ae

# FeeLogic Rules Engine — Environments

FeeLogic evaluates shipping-fee rules for the Corvelle storefronts. We run three environments: sandbox (synthetic orders, rules reload every minute), staging (mirrors production rule sets nightly), and production (change-controlled, rules deploy via the Brindlegate pipeline only). Sandbox is safe for experiments; staging is for pre-release validation and is what the weekly sync demos use. Note that rate tables differ per environment by design. The current staging configuration values are reproduced below.

service settings:
PRAIX_LOG_LEVEL=error
PRAIX_METRICS_HOST=metrics.praix.qorvelcorp.corp
PRAIX_POOL_SIZE=16